Although the workings of Blender may seem intimidating, it can be a gratifying learning experience for ...Jan 3, 2024 · The good news is that Spanish is one of the easiest languages to learn for native English speakers. That being said, it still takes time. The Foreign Service Institute suggests a timeline of 24 weeks, or about 600 class hours, for full fluency in the language. This more or less aligns with my experience. As you can see from the above table (made by Instituto Cervantes for Spanish students), our rough approximation of how long does it take to learn a language can be divided by language level. A1 = 15% of study time. A2 = 15% of study time. B1 = 25% of study time. B2 = 25% of study time. C1 = 25% of study time.How long does it take to learn Spanish with Rosetta Stone? However, the FSI asserts that fluency in either language is achievable in ...Feb 15, 2024 · B1 Level (Intermediate): 300-360 hours. B2 Level (Upper-Intermediate): 540-620 hours. According to the CEFR, conversational fluency emerges at the B2 level after dedicating 540-620 hours of intentional practice. This milestone is achievable in 12-24 months through consistent habits.
